Micro Puff Hoody Women, by Patagonia, is a highly compressible synthetic down jacket.
It combines an ultralight Pertex® Quantum outer fabric with PlumaFill insulation. It offers the best weight-to-warmth ratio of all Patagonia jackets.
It is the essential insulating jacket for facing the cold and mixed (or downright bad) conditions.
The outer fabric is made of 100% post-consumer recycled NetPlus® ripstop nylon, manufactured from recycled fishing nets, and the insulation is made of 100% recycled polyester.
Main features
- Ultralight and windproof Pertex® Quantum outer fabric in 100% post-consumer recycled NetPlus® ripstop nylon made from recycled fishing nets to reduce plastic pollution in the oceans; with PFC-free (no perfluorinated chemical compounds) durable water repellent (DWR) finish.
- Revolutionary PlumaFill insulation offering groundbreaking lightness and benefiting from the same structure as down insulation with a uniform synthetic material that provides the warmth and compressibility of down, even when wet.
- Innovative quilting that enhances insulation by holding and maximizing the loft of PlumaFill fibers with minimal seaming.
- Front zip with storm flap and chin guard for added comfort at the chin; freedom-of-movement-focused cut, compatible with wearing a harness or backpack.
- Two zippered and welted handwarmer pockets; left pocket also doubles as a stuff sack and features a reinforced carabiner clip; two interior drop-in pockets.
- Simple, lightweight hood that sits comfortably under a helmet.
- Elastic cuffs and adjustable hem to retain warmth.
- This style is made with Fair Trade Certified™ sewing, which means the workers who made it earned a premium for their labor.
